Acceptance of Plan Today or Germany Mobilises Tomorrow
(United Press Association — By Electric Telegraph—Copyright.)
Received September 28, 1 p.m.
LONDON. September 27. It was announced by radio from Berlin that unless Czechoslovakia accepted the German memorandum by 2 p.m. on September 28 Germany will mobilise on Thursday. Reuters' Belgrade correspondent reports that Hungarian mobilisation has started. It war **if*ounc>>d after a meeting of Cabinet that the British Fleet was mobilising. The Admiralty announced that the mobilisation of the Fleet is a precautionary measure.
